Synthesis of new pyrrolidine-based organocatalysts and study of their use in the asymmetric Michael addition of aldehydes to nitroolefins
作者:Alejandro Castán、Ramón Badorrey、José A Gálvez、María D Díaz-de-Villegas
DOI:10.3762/bjoc.13.59
日期:——
pyrrolidine-based organocatalysts with a bulky substituent at C2 were synthesized from chiral imines derivedfrom (R)-glyceraldehyde acetonide by diastereoselective allylation followed by a sequential hydrozirconation/iodination reaction. The new compounds were found to be effective organocatalysts for the Michael addition of aldehydes to nitroolefins and enantioselectivities up to 85% ee were achieved
